Your role in our team- You will develop machine processes with support from mechanical engineering
- You will assist with the selection of electrical components
- You will create programs to control machines using Allen Bradley Studio 5000 software
- You will design HMIs for machine control using Allen Bradley FTView Studio ME software
- You will review the safety circuit design and complete machine safety system programming
- You will provide suggestions for design improvements or changes during all phases of machine design
- You will integrate third party equipment into machine functions
- You will debug and prepare the machine for factory acceptance testing (FAT)
- You will review the operating manuals prepared by the technical writer
- You will travel to the customer's facility for machine integration and site acceptance testing (SAT)
- You will communicate and interact with customers in a positive and professional manner
Your profile- You have a Bachelor of Science degree in Electrical or Mechanical Engineering or equivalent required
- You have experience in programming PLC's, robots, and creating operator interfaces preferred
- You are familiar with other programming languages a plus (Python, C++, C#, VB)
- You have experience in a manufacturing environment preferred
- You are able to travel up to 25%
